Is 133696181 a prime number?
It is possible to find out using mathematical methods whether a given integer is a prime number or not.
Yes, 133 696 181 is a prime number.
Indeed, the definition of a prime numbers is to have exactly two distinct positive divisors, 1 and itself. A number is a divisor of another number when the remainder of Euclid’s division of the second one by the first one is zero. Concerning the number 133 696 181, the only two divisors are 1 and 133 696 181. Therefore 133 696 181 is a prime number.
As a consequence, 133 696 181 is only a multiple of 1 and 133 696 181.
